From 3c7aee90a1dfccdd2506d403d2b56b5d7cfb258a Mon Sep 17 00:00:00 2001 From: GHITA999 <gmoubarik@gmail.com> Date: Fri, 18 Sep 2020 17:53:23 +0200 Subject: [PATCH] debut02 --- tp1/TeachingUnitResult.java | 2 ++ tp1/TestTeachingUnitResult.java | 35 +++++++++++++++++++++++++++++++++ 2 files changed, 37 insertions(+) create mode 100644 tp1/TestTeachingUnitResult.java diff --git a/tp1/TeachingUnitResult.java b/tp1/TeachingUnitResult.java index c052586..ada666b 100644 --- a/tp1/TeachingUnitResult.java +++ b/tp1/TeachingUnitResult.java @@ -26,6 +26,7 @@ public class TeachingUnitResult { * @return the grade associated to the result */ public Grade getGrade() { + return grade; } /** @@ -34,5 +35,6 @@ public class TeachingUnitResult { */ @Override public String toString() { + return (teachingUnitName+" : "+grade+":20"); } } diff --git a/tp1/TestTeachingUnitResult.java b/tp1/TestTeachingUnitResult.java new file mode 100644 index 0000000..5a571c8 --- /dev/null +++ b/tp1/TestTeachingUnitResult.java @@ -0,0 +1,35 @@ +import java.util.ArrayList; + +public class TestTeachingUnitResult { + public static void main(String[] args){ + TestTeachingUnitResult test = new TestTeachingUnitResult(); + if(test.testToString() == true) + System.out.println("testToString : correct"); + else + System.out.println("testToString : incorrect"); + + if (test.testGetGrade() == true) + System.out.println("testGetGrade : correct"); + else + System.out.println("testGetGrade : incorrect"); + + } + + + private boolean testGetGrade() { + Grade grade = new Grade(12.5); + double val = grade.getValue(); + if(val == 12.5) + return true; + else + return false; + + } + private boolean testToString(){ + Grade grade = new Grade(16.80); + String gradeString = grade.toString(); + if (gradeString.equals("16;80/20")) + return true; + else + return false; +}} -- GitLab